Goal
- opatch lsinventory shows one node in uppercase (incorrect one) and the other node in lowercase (correct one) $ opatch lsinventory
Oracle Grid Infrastructure 11g 11.2.0.4.0
There are 1 product(s) installed in this Oracle Home.
There are no Interim patches installed in this Oracle Home.
Rac system comprising of multiple nodes
Local node = rac1
Remote node = RAC2 <<<<< Uppercase, incorrect one.
- From the central inventory, it shows an uppercase hostname. $ cat /u01/app/oraInventory/ContentsXML/inventory.xml
...
<HOME NAME="Ora11g_gridinfrahome1" LOC="/apps/oracle/product/11.2.0.4.GRD" TYPE="O" IDX="1" CRS="true">
<NODE_LIST>
<NODE NAME="rac1"/>
<NODE NAME="RAC2"/> <<<<< Upper-case, incorrect one.
</NODE_LIST>
</HOME>
...
Solution
To change the hostname from uppercase to lowercase for a particular ORACLE_HOME:
- Run the following command on each node to rectify the uppercase host name in the inventory, as the software owner:
$ $ORACLE_HOME/oui/bin/runInstaller -updateNodeList ORACLE_HOME="/apps/oracle/product/11.2.0.4.GRD" "CLUSTER_NODES={rac1,rac2}" -silent -local
- Verify the changes by repeating the command “opatch lsinventory” and “cat oraInventory/ContentsXML/inventory.xml”
